DEITIES OF DRAGONLANCE
from pg. 295 of the 5E Player's Handbook
=====================================
Paladine, god of rulers and guardians (LG)
Branchala, god of music (NG)
Habbakuk, god of animal life and the sea (NG)
Kiri-Jolith, god of honor and war (LG)
Majere, god of meditation and order (LG)
Mishakal, goddess of healing (LG)
Solinari, god of good magic (LG)
Gilean, god of knowledge (N)
Chislev, goddess of nature (N)
Reorx, god of craft (N)
Shinare, goddess of wealth and trade (N)
Sirrion, god of fire and change (N)
Zivilyn, god of wisdom (N)
Lunitari, goddess of neutral magic (N)
Takhisis, goddess of night and hatred (LE)
Chemosh, god of the undead (LE)
Hiddukel, god of lies and greed (CE)
Morgion, god of disease and secrecy (NE)
Sargonnas, god of vengeance and fire (LE)
Zeboim, goddess of the sea and storms (CE)
Nuitari, god of evil magic (LE)
